引言在现代Web开发中,jQuery、JSON和Ajax是三种不可或缺的技术。它们共同构成了高效、动态的用户界面的基础。本文将深入探讨这三种技术的融合,展示如何轻松实现数据交互与动态网页。jQuery...
在现代Web开发中,jQuery、JSON和Ajax是三种不可或缺的技术。它们共同构成了高效、动态的用户界面的基础。本文将深入探讨这三种技术的融合,展示如何轻松实现数据交互与动态网页。
jQuery是一个高效的JavaScript库,它简化了JavaScript编程,提供了丰富的选择器、DOM操作、事件处理以及动画效果。jQuery的核心特性是它能够使DOM操作变得简单,从而提高了开发效率。
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人阅读和编写,同时也易于机器解析和生成。它是与语言无关的,但与JavaScript语法有着紧密的关系,使得JavaScript可以很方便地处理JSON数据。
Ajax(Asynchronous JavaScript and XML)是一种创建交互式、快速动态网页应用的网页开发技术。它允许在不重新加载整个页面的情况下,与服务器交换数据并更新部分网页内容。
jQuery、JSON和Ajax的融合可以实现强大的数据交互和动态网页功能。
$.ajax({ url: "data.json", dataType: "json", success: function(data) { // 更新DOM $("#element").html(data.name); }, error: function() { // 错误处理 }
});以下是一个简单的动态网页实例,展示如何使用jQuery、JSON和Ajax实现数据交互。
$("#loadButton").click(function() { $.ajax({ url: "data.json", dataType: "json", success: function(data) { $("#element").html(data.name); }, error: function() { alert("加载失败!"); } });
});jQuery、JSON和Ajax的融合为Web开发带来了极大的便利。通过本文的介绍,相信您已经对这三种技术的融合有了更深入的了解。在今后的Web开发中,充分利用这些技术,实现数据交互与动态网页,将使您的网页更加生动、实用。